Internet Addiction and the Social alienation of Algerian Youth

This study aims to determine the prevalence of internet addiction among young people in Algeria and the effects of this phenomenon on their social relationships. As the Internet has grown in importance among young people in Algeria, their patterns of social interaction with their families, relatives, and the rest of their social environment are likely to change.
The results of the field study revealed new social interaction patterns among young people that depend on digital and electronic spaces and media. This had a negative impact on traditional communication patterns, but also opened up new possibilities for social relationships, especially with immigrants and their relatives.
